See the * GNU General Public License for more details. * * You should have received a copy of the GNU General Public License * along with this program; if not, write to the Free Software * Foundation, Inc., 51 Franklin St, Fifth Floor, Boston, MA 02110-1301 USA * * ------------------------------------------------------------------------- * * This is slightly modified routine from the Cephes library: * http://www.netlib.org/cephes/  */#include <itpp/base/bessel/bessel_internal.h>/* * Evaluate polynomial * * int N; * double x, y, coef[N+1], polevl[]; * * y = polevl( x, coef, N ); * * DESCRIPTION: * * Evaluates polynomial of degree N: * *                     2          N * y  =  C  + C x + C x  +...+ C x *        0    1     2          N * * Coefficients are stored in reverse order: * * coef[0] = C  , ..., coef[N] = C  . *            N                   0 * *  The function p1evl() assumes that coef[N] = 1.0 and is * omitted from the array.  Its calling arguments are * otherwise the same as polevl(). * * SPEED: * * In the interest of speed, there are no checks for out * of bounds arithmetic.  This routine is used by most of * the functions in the library.  Depending on available * equipment features, the user may wish to rewrite the * program in microcode or assembly language. *//*  Cephes Math Library Release 2.1:  December, 1988  Copyright 1984, 1987, 1988 by Stephen L. Moshier*/double polevl(double x, double coef[], int N){  double ans;  int i;  double *p;  p = coef;  ans = *p++;  i = N;  do    ans = ans * x  +  *p++;  while( --i );  return( ans );}/*                                          N * Evaluate polynomial when coefficient of x  is 1.0. * Otherwise same as polevl. */double p1evl(double x, double coef[], int N){  double ans;  double *p;  int i;  p = coef;  ans = x + *p++;  i = N-1;  do    ans = ans * x  + *p++;  while( --i );  return( ans );}
